Why we score The Paw Grocer Ultimate Training Treats Value Bundle 8.8/10

This is a 500g bundle built for owners who train a lot and burn through treats quickly, pulling together a spread of proteins so your dog doesn't get bored of the same flavour week after week. What stands out is the value-per-gram of buying in a bundle and the variety, which is genuinely useful for keeping reward-based training fresh and engaging. It suits active trainers, puppy classes, and multi-dog households who want one order to last. As an occasional treat, feed it alongside a complete, balanced diet and keep treats to no more than about 10% of your dog's daily calories.
